/* el programa va a encender un led cuando el boton es presionado
y al ser liberado dicho boton , el led se apagara
OBSERVACIONES FISICAS : RESISTENCIA PULL DOWN (O PULL UP segun necesidad)
OBSERVACIONES LOGICAS : SENTENCIA "if" NO TERMINA CON PUNTO Y COMA
es posible simular el efecto de rebote propio del interruptor */
void setup() {
pinMode(2, INPUT); // definimos que el pin 2 es una entrada (PULSADOR N/A)
pinMode(3, OUTPUT); // definimos que el pin 3 es una salida (LED)
}
void loop() {
if (digitalRead(2)==HIGH) // observo que hay a la entrada, ATENTI, aqui no hay PUNNTO y COMA !!
// si hay un estado alto (pulsador accionado) o hay un estado bajo
digitalWrite(3, HIGH); // escribo en la salida (LED) un "1", o sea, lo prendo.
else
digitalWrite(3, LOW); // escribo en la salida (LED) un "0", ol sea, lo apago.
}